
Ligon Duncan
Pastor and theologian, known for his emphasis on the pastoral epistles and historical theology. He delivered a keynote at TGC's 2009 National Conference, focusing on faithful ministry.

Fighting the Good Fight (2 Tim. 4:6–22)
Ligon Duncan, a prominent pastor and theologian known for his insights on the pastoral epistles, encourages a return to foundational teachings in church ministry. He critiques the dangers of theological liberalism and disconnected methodologies. Duncan emphasizes the importance of enduring faithfulness, studying diligently, and fostering gospel community. He reflects on the loneliness in ministry while urging perseverance and boldness in sharing one’s faith. His insights highlight God’s grace as a source of strength amid challenges, reaffirming the significance of Scripture in the Christian life.

Ligon Duncan Tells Me Where I'm Wrong on Infant Baptism
Ligon Duncan, an expert in infant baptism, joins Russell Moore to discuss the importance of baptism and its historical context. They explore the significance of the Abrahamic covenant, the differences between Baptist and Presbyterian beliefs, and the distinction between baptism and the Lord's Supper. Duncan also shares his perspective on nominal Christianity and the challenges it poses.
